SVLDRS discharge certificate cannot be denied for delayed payment of tax which was recredited due to a technical glitch

SK Likproof Private Limited Vs Union of India (Gujarat High Court)

HC held that, when the deposit within the stipulated time period was made, technical glitch being the reason for the non-functioning of the bank’s software would not hold the assessee liable or accountable for non-payment....

Adverse view against innocent regular investor due to misuse of some person to rig certain shares is unjustified

ITO Vs Ronak Iqbal Lakhani (ITAT Mumbai)

ITAT Mumbai held that merely because some person misused the share market to rig certain shares in the share market, adverse view against innocent regular investor is unjustifiable and unsustainable in law....

Bail granted in fraudulent ITC claim matter as co-accused already released on bail

Shubham Khandelwal Vs State of NCT of Delhi (Delhi High Court)

Delhi High Court held granted bail, in fraudulent claim of ITC under GST, as bail already granted to co-accused and petitioner had no prior criminal antecedents....
